1. Introduction In the Spanish education system (and many Latin American curricula), Bachillerato represents the final two years of secondary education (typically ages 16–18). Two key branches of mathematics taught at this level are Probability (randomness, uncertainty, chance) and Statistics (data collection, analysis, interpretation, and inference).
